The COPD Score in 48623, Freeland, Michigan is 79 out of 100 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.
88.63 percent of the population in 48623 drive to work alone. 0.00 percent of the people take some form of public transportation like the bus or the train to work. Approximately 78.91 percent of the residents get to work in less than 30 minutes. 4.64 percent of the residents in 48623 get to work in more than 60 minutes. The average household size is approximately 2.76 members with about 2.34 cars available per household.
An estimate of 86.98 percent of the residents in 48623 has some form of health insurance. 25.84 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 74.24 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ase.
A resident in 48623 would have to travel an average of 5.60 miles to reach the nearest hospital with an emergency room, Healthsource Saginaw . In a 20-mile radius, there are 0 healthcare providers accessible to residents in 48623, Freeland, Michigan.

COPD, or chronic obstructive pulmonary disease, is a chronic inflammatory lung disease that causes obstructed airflow from the lungs. It can lead to coughing, wheezing, shortness of breath, and other symptoms. Managing COPD often requires regular check-ups with healthcare providers, as well as access to medication and treatment plans.
